Pirates Invade - Much Fun Had by All
The 2007 Billy Bowlegs Pirate Festival winds down with the torchlight parade in Fort Walton Beach on Monday night at 8pm. Friday night saw a good crowd in spite of high winds early in the evening. The finale seemed a bit short, but you can play it back with our video coverage below.
North winds and moderate temperatures created ideal weather for more than 1500 boats which came out for the pirate invasion at the Fort Walton Beach Landing. According to an article in the Northwest Florida Daily News, improved boater temperament, increased law enforcement presence, and more organized anchoring areas combined to alleviate arrests for aggressive behavior which was a problem last year. Boating under the influence arrests ticked slightly up to 18 and there were a reported 13 ‘medical emergencies’ due to accidents.
